ITA is a Sector & Thematic ETF from iShares holding 44 positions as of Mar 31, 2026, with $14.8B in assets and a 0.38% net expense ratio. Its largest positions are GE (19.0%), RTX (16.6%) and BA (8.9%); the top 10 holdings account for 74.9% of the portfolio. By sector it leans Industrials (99.8%) and Consumer Discretionary (0.1%). It yields 0.42% on a trailing-12-month basis.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is ITA's expense ratio?
ITA has a net expense ratio of 0.38%, per its latest SEC prospectus filing. That works out to about $38 a year on a $10,000 investment.
How many holdings does ITA have?
ITA held 44 positions as of Mar 31, 2026, per its latest official holdings data. Cash, collateral and derivative positions (1.4% of portfolio weight) are excluded from that count.
What are ITA's top 10 holdings?
ITA's largest positions are GE (19.0%), RTX (16.6%), BA (8.9%), GD (4.8%), LHX (4.7%), LMT (4.6%), NOC (4.6%), TDG (4.5%), HWM (4.5%), AXON (2.8%). Together they account for 74.9% of the portfolio.
What is ITA's dividend yield?
ITA yields 0.42% based on its trailing 12-month distributions, as of Aug 7, 2026.
How big is ITA?
ITA has $14.8B in assets as of Aug 10, 2026.
What are good alternatives to ITA?
By portfolio overlap, the closest Sector & Thematic ETFs to ITA are PPA (68% overlap), XAR (52% overlap), SHLD (32% overlap). Overlap measures the share of portfolio weight both funds hold in the same securities.
